Arnott Introduces Coil Spring Conversion for E-Class W211 Chassis

Arnott Introduces Mercedes-Benz Coil Spring Conversion Kit

New Offering Addresses 2003-2009 E-Class W211 Chassis
and 2005-2011 CLS-Class W219 Chassis with AIRMATIC

Arnott Air Suspension Products - the leader in aftermarket automotive air suspension parts and accessories - announced the introduction of a new Coil Spring Conversion Kit for the 2003-2009 Mercedes-Benz® E-Class W211 Chassis and 2005-2011 CLS-Class W219 Chassis with AIRMATIC®. The kit is in stock for immediate shipping, marking yet another milestone in the ongoing expansion of the company's industry-leading line of high-quality, affordable air suspension replacement parts for Mercedes-Benz vehicles in particular, and luxury cars, trucks, and SUVs in general.

The Mercedes-Benz Coil S pring Conversion Kit, Arnott part number C-2278, retails for $1,599 and includes a core return rebate of $150, making the net price after rebate a remarkable $1,449 ... often less than the price of one air strut from an authorized Mercedes-Benz dealership.

In North America, the kit is backed by Arnott's Limited Lifetime Warranty; it carries a Two-Year Limited Warranty in the rest of the world. A detailed Installation Manual is included to ensure a safe and successful conversion
